Police have confirmed that a body found in July in a southern Oregon ravine was that of Charles Levin, a former Hollywood actor who had been missing from his Grants Pass home for several days.
Reports from Grants Pass Public Safety show that police officers were contacted July 8 by Levin’s son Jesse, who reported his father missing.
Levin, who was known for TV appearances on shows including “Seinfeld,” “The Golden Girls” and “Hill Street Blues," was last seen June 27. Levin’s car, an orange Fiat, was found July 13, with the remains of his dog, a pug named Boo Boo, found on the floor of the passenger side. A body was found outside the car and was believed to be Levin’s, but police didn’t immediately confirm the identity of the remains in July.
Police reports released to the public in November confirm the body as Levin’s and describe a search for the missing man that included combing miles of rugged backcountry roads, as well as tracking by Air Force mapping and search and rescue crews. Police “pinged” Levin’s phone, which was last tracked on Eight Dollar Mountain, and had not had any activity since July 4.
